Publisher's Synopsis

Regency Rogues.

Christmas Seductions.

Danyl Fitzhugh vows he can turn any woman, even innocent Sarah Branford, into an actress. But Sarah is more than she seems.

Captain Fergus Lamont has invited Susanna Hunter to spend Christmas with him in the Highlands.

He suggests she pretends to be his fiancée.

Lord Crispin Sinclair will come home for his brother's Christmas nuptials only if widow Lady Caroline Fallowfield will share his bed.

Notorious rake Camden Folk, Marquis of Warbury desires beautiful Frances Burdett. And Yuletide at his country estate is perfect for her seduction.

Juliana Wright needs the help of devilishly handsome Captain Rawden Wood, a renowned pirate. But he could dishonour her or reveal her biggest secret!
